From Detection to Decision: Why Data Observability Is Becoming Core to Enterprise Transformation

Enterprise data architectures have changed.
Federated ownership, AI adoption, and domain-driven data products are now the norm across retail, financial services, media, and manufacturing. Yet one challenge persists across every transformation programme: decision trust.
Most observability platforms detect technical anomalies. Very few translate those signals into business impact, governance alignment, and safe-to-act intelligence.
For system integrators, this shift creates both risk and opportunity.
In this session, we will explore:
- Why detection alone is no longer sufficient
- Where modern data mesh and federated architectures break
- How decision-centric observability reduces delivery risk and unlocks recurring services
- How Sifflet partners co-sell, deliver, and scale observability programmes
- The commercial and enablement model behind our 2026 Partner Program
If you are delivering enterprise data platforms and want to embed decision trust into every transformation, this session is for you.
